2016 - 2024

感恩一路有你

redis 快速导入数据

浏览量:2775 时间:2023-10-27 20:34:55 作者:采采

Redis是一种高性能的开源内存数据库,在实际应用中经常需要将大量数据导入到Redis中。本文将介绍一种快速导入数据到Redis的方法,并提供了一些优化技巧,以加快导入速度。

步骤一: 准备数据

首先,需要准备好待导入的数据。可以将数据存储在文件中,每行代表一个数据项。数据可以是文本格式的键值对,也可以是其他格式。

步骤二: 使用Redis命令行工具

打开终端,进入Redis的安装目录,执行以下命令连接到Redis服务器:

```

redis-cli

```

步骤三: 导入数据

使用Redis的命令行工具可以通过批量导入数据文件的方式快速导入数据。执行以下命令:

```

redis-cli --pipe < data.txt

```

其中,data.txt为待导入的数据文件名。

步骤四: 优化导入速度

如果数据量较大,导入速度可能会受到限制。以下是一些优化方法,可用于提升导入速度:

1. 使用多个Redis实例:将数据分散到多个Redis实例中导入,以充分利用系统资源。

2. 批量处理数据:将待导入的数据分批次读取并导入,避免一次性导入过多数据导致内存不足。

3. 关闭持久化功能:在导入数据时,可以暂时关闭Redis的持久化功能,以提高导入速度。

4. 调整Redis配置:根据系统的硬件资源和网络带宽情况,适当调整Redis的配置参数,以优化导入性能。

总结:

本文详细介绍了如何快速导入数据到Redis,包括准备数据、使用Redis命令行工具导入数据以及优化导入速度的方法。通过运用这些技巧,可以提高Redis数据导入的效率,节省时间和资源。

Redis 数据导入 导入速度优化 Redis数据导入详细步骤

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。